nurse assesses a patient's skin after an ice bag has been applied. Which of the following findings would indicate that the ice bag is too cold?
 
  1. Pink, cool skin
  2. Warm, red skin
  3. Cool, scaly skin
  4. Pale, mottled skin

The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) was originally known as the Communicable Disease Center, which was formed to fight malaria. It was originally headquartered in Atlanta, Georgia, since the Southern states faced the worst threat from malaria.
